  Staying Ahead of the Flame Game

Staying Ahead of the Flame Game

November 1, 2008

Nine people died each day in structural fires in the United States in 2007 - 3,430 people in that year. And while there was a 5.2 percent decrease of reported fires during 2007, property damage climbed significantly by 29.5 percent from 2006. However, the industry's recent efforts to legislate better fire protection - taking advantage of improved technologies - have spurred changes in fire code that will help reduce the loss of lives and property.
